Whether you are looking for function or beauty, there are lots of ways to fill the space. You can find interesting pieces at sales or choose a special piece for your bedroom. We list below for you, 10 things that can complement your bedroom.

  • TV cabinet: The newest 'must-have' for a bedroom is a cabinet with a TV that goes up and down at the touch of a remote control button. By day, you have a cabinet or bench, and by night you have an eye-level flat screen TV. Wow! But, this comes with a heavy price.
  • Upholstered bench: A large bench can catch the bedspread at night, hold a tray of goodies or serve as a great place to sit. Choose a fabric cover that enhances your decor. It can be in neutrals for winters and light florals for summers. Cooling, isn't it...
  • Storage bench: Whether a wooden one or upholstered, it is a perfect place to put bedding, pillows and extra linens. It's a great place to sit and slip on those sandals/shoes.
  • Skirted table: If you have a small round, oblong or oval table, this will work perfectly. Purchase a floor-length tablecloth that coordinates with the decor of your bedroom. If you have more space, add a small side chair on each end of the table.
  • Pair of chairs: If you love to read, you can place two small-upholstered armchairs or side chairs at the end of your bed. You can add a small reading lamp, for full effect. Alas! You have a comfortable, private reading corner.
  • Loveseat: A small loveseat is great at the end of queen or king size bed. Add a good floor lamp close-by for reading. Decorate the loveseat with a soft blanket and pretty pillows.
  • Low Cabinet or Chest: A long, low piece will look better in most rooms. The drawers are great for linen storage, books, craft supplies, and CD's or DVD's. A nice piece of wood furniture gives a good balance to a bedroom's upholstered look.
  • Wicker or Iron bench: The end of a bed is a great place to put an unusual piece of furniture that adds character to your bedroom. Iron and wicker look great with the casual interiors or rooms with a vintage look. Add a pretty plaid or floral cushion to coordinate with the rest of the room.
  • Writing desk: With a small writing desk at the end of your bed, you will be able to use and enjoy your bedroom during the day. Read your mail, write a letter, make your shopping list or a phone call. Everything can be done from the comforts of your bedroom.
  • Table: A pedestal or library table can provide space for your books, collections, family photos or a small television. The table should not be more that 8 inches taller than top of your mattress.
